5 WAYS TO LOWER COOLING COSTS THIS SUMMER – HOW TO SAVE ENERGY IN SUMMER?

“It can be tricky to keep a home comfortable in the summer. That is why, particularly during the hot summer months, it is vital to know strategies to cut cooling costs.”

During the summer, you would like to keep your home cool. However, realizing that you are paying more for cooling than your neighbor can be irritating. Learn how to use some ideas to reduce cooling costs in your house and reduce your monthly electricity bill.

These tricks will not only lead to significant savings on cooling but will also help you save energy!

  • BLOCK THE SUNLIGHT

Bright sunlight entering your home will raise the temperature inside to an uncomfortably high level. Blocking daytime sunshine is one of the easiest ways to keep your house cool while using less energy.

Once the sun is at its hottest, you must close your windows or blinds. Consider cultivating shade trees outside big windows as a long-term solution. Trees increase the value and beauty of your property while also reducing your house cooling costs in the long run.

  • FANS HELP TO SAVE ON COOLING COSTS

Fans do not decrease the temperature of a room. They do, however, make the air appear cooler. They can help keep your home cool using a wind chill factor. You don’t need to run ceiling fans if nobody is home since they don’t lower the temperature. This is a waste of electricity.

If nobody is home, it is not essential to use ceiling fans because it has no impact on the real temperature of the room.

  • PREVENT HEAT BUILD-UP DURING THE DAY

When the temperature outside is higher than the temperature inside your home, avoid activities that produce a lot of heat, such as cooking on the gas stove or using the dishwasher and clothes dryer. Instead, try microwaving or grilling food outside, hand-washing dishes and making them air dry, and hanging clothes on a rope. Generally, avoidance will save you money on electricity—as well as the cost of making that AC work overtime.

  • MAINTENANCE TASKS MUST BE COMPLETED

Maintaining your air conditioner regularly will help it operate at peak performance. Washing or changing the air filter with time, moving any furniture or drapes that are blocking your ventilation duct, and making space around the outdoor compressor unit are all examples of simple DIY maintenance.

Schedule a regular HVAC maintenance visit to keep your air conditioner in good working order. A specialist can service parts that you are unable to reach and can assist you in avoiding expensive system breakdowns.

There are many other ways of reducing cooling costs in your home, but these are likely the most efficient using your existing HVAC system.
